Transaction 58566b77251041474839ee35781c9698d141a6dc45e50d94f65015508f2dea1e
1 Input
-
358a2dfdd51a864a5c03e9acb6ab0db4dfe2454b053b9258f24c466366524fd5:0
OP_DATA_48(48) 45022100bc7ba5225557b476a23a97eaa47adf0a694c05659fc2c087c35b87222fd532db02203eecbe105d2cd73ce2c5
2 Outputs
- 58566b77251041474839ee35781c9698d141a6dc45e50d94f65015508f2dea1e:0
- 58566b77251041474839ee35781c9698d141a6dc45e50d94f65015508f2dea1e:1
value 8397679
address 372iSedppYs7tsLfxwCyx8BHCy4xFmi7N3
value 772467
address 3PsM1ogQQPxrpKW6PHq1qvvHfnefwtoeaS